Agriculture is the practice of cultivating soil, planting and harvesting crops, and raising livestock to produce food products. It is the foundation of the global food system - the primary source of all the food we consume. Combined with forestry and aquaculture, the agriculture industry produces around 11 billion tons of food and 32 MT of natural fibers. Agriculture and the food industry are central to food supply, increasing employment, and strengthening the global trade sector. This sector is considered 2-3 times more effective at reducing poverty by creating millions of jobs across the supply chain. Did you know that around half of the world's population works in agriculture or is somehow related to this industry? Additionally, the economic growth of various countries also depends heavily on agriculture and the food industry.
The earliest evidence of agriculture was found in modern-day Iraq, Israel, Jordan, Syria, and Lebanon. The Natufian culture inhabited this area around 9500 BCE, and they used to cultivate wheat and barley. It is believed that in the northeastern countries, the last ice age witnessed some major climatic changes which brought favourable conditions for annual plants like wild cereals. Furthermore, the origin of rice and millet farming dates back to the Neolithic period in China. After the discovery of the most common agricultural foods was done, it was then divided into two types of crops - field crops (pulses, oil seeds, cereals, etc) and horticultural crops (apples, strawberries, etc). Agricultural food is a basic human need, whether you’re a dedicated vegetarian or have a more diverse diet. But at the same time, not every country can be rich in all types of agricultural products. This is due to the uneven distribution of land and the varied climatic conditions of different countries. All of which is responsible for the agriculture and food trade among various countries. India especially has a strong presence in the global agricultural trade. It stands at the 8th rank among the world's largest agriculture exporting countries, with its major markets in Bangladesh, the USA, China, Vietnam, the UAE, Indonesia, and others. Indian spices are in high demand in most of these countries.

1. Where can I sell agricultural and food products?
You can sell your agricultural products locally (in your local grocery stores, restaurants, and hotels) or sell them globally to different countries.
2. What are the food safety requirements for exporting agricultural products?
The food safety requirement for exporting agricultural products requires you to get all the necessary certificates and licenses, such as FSSAI, phytosanitary certificate, and others.
3. What is the largest agricultural export of India?
Rice (Basmati and Non-basmati) is the largest agricultural export of India.
4. Which country is the biggest agricultural importer?
The US is the biggest importer of agricultural products.
5. What is the role of APEDA in agricultural exports?
Agricultural and Processed Food Products Export Development Authority is a primary statutory body for export promotion, quality improvement, and global market development.
6. What is the role of trade agreements in agricultural exports?
Trade agreements reduce agricultural trade barriers among various countries. They create more efficient agricultural trade systems and hence, increase the export opportunities.
